Historian Dr Andrew Davies said: There was a big problem with unemployment in Glasgow. Van operators were frequently subjected to violence and intimidation and in 1984 one driver, Andrew Doyle, and five members of his family were killed in an arson attack. When 18-year-old Andrew Doyle refused to bow to intimidation, he and his family were targeted with horrific consequences. Divorced Jamie, 45, is the driving force behind the family. By the early 2000's McGraw was one of the wealthiest businessmen in Glasgow, with security companies, taxi firms as well as properties in Scotland, Ireland, and Spain including Tenerife. One evening in late February 1984, shots had been fired through the windscreen of Andrew's ice cream van in Balveny Street, Garthamlock, while he was working with his 15-year-old girl assistant. This brought him to the attention of MI5, and in return for passing on information, Arthur Thompson was granted immunity of prosecution, leaving him virtually free to do as he liked.
